Learn to make a felt story from the book “Raven”. A story that will take the children on an adventure to learn more about the Aboriginal Culture.
Objectives:
- To be able to understand about ravens and their importance to First Nations People.
- To be able to make a felt story where children can participate re-telling the story.
- To be able to draw their own “Raven” story.
- To be able to extend the book in order to explore other stories from First Nations Culture.
